In the 20th week of the Premier League, Liverpool took a 2-1 lead in the 90+4th minute but ended up drawing 2-2 with Fulham after conceding a goal in the final seconds.

In the 20th week of the Premier League, Fulham faced Liverpool. The match played at Craven Cottage ended in a 2-2 draw.

BIG SHOCK FOR LIVERPOOL WHO TOOK THE LEAD IN 90+4

Fulham took the lead in the 17th minute with a goal from Harry Wilson, who was transferred from Liverpool, and finished the first half ahead. Liverpool equalized in the 57th minute with a goal from German star Florian Wirtz. The English giant, increasing its pressure in the final moments, took the lead in 90+4 with Cody Gakpo. As the last seconds of the match were being played, Harrison Reed, who came on for Fulham, scored a fantastic goal in 90+7 to determine the final score of the match.

UNBEATEN STREAK REACHED 8 MATCHES

With this match, Liverpool extended their unbeaten streak to 8 matches, raising their points to 34. Fulham increased their points to 28. In the next match of the league, Liverpool will visit the leader Arsenal. Fulham will face Chelsea at home.
